Question Although I have set my ScanSnap for "Automatic blank page removal", it continues to create blank images. Why does this happen?
Answer
ScanSnap may continue to create blank images if you scan irregularly shaped documents or photographs whose reverse sides contain writing. To prevent this from occurring, either scan such items in simplex or place a white sheet of A4 sized paper behind the document.

[Note]
Please change your ScanSnap to the following settings when scanning in simplex.
  1. "Right-click" the "ScanSnap Manager" icon that appears in the task bar and then select "Simplex Scan (Single-sided)", which appears in the "Settings" menu.



  2. Select "Scanning mode" from the "Scan and Save Settings" window.

  3. Select "Simplex Scan (Single-sided)" in the "SCAN button" box.
